Latest Patents

Yuzuriha's latest patents include a cutting-edge fuel cell module. This module features a unique casing design with hollow surface members, forming a continuous air channel that optimizes airflow. The design incorporates a fluid inlet on the front surface, enhancing the efficiency of the fuel cell unit. Additionally, he has developed a sophisticated fuel cell system and method for controlling the system. This control device includes an electric conductivity comparing unit, allowing for real-time assessment of water quality in an ion exchanger, determining the efficiency of ion exchange and the presence of air contamination.
